[pulseaudio-discuss] Pulseaudio 5.0 compilation error: ./.libs/libpulse.so: undefined reference to `is_error'

Dâniel Fraga fragabr at gmail.com
Mon Aug 4 18:54:38 PDT 2014


	I'm trying to compile Pulseaudio 5.0 with gcc 4.9.1 and I get
the following:

libtool: link: gcc -std=gnu99 -pthread -DPA_SRCDIR=\"/home/fraga/src/pulseaudio-5.0/src\" -DPA_BUILDDIR=\"/home/fraga/src/pulseaudio-5.0/src\" -I/usr/local/include/dbus-1.0 -I/usr/local/lib/dbus-1.0/include -march=native -O3 -pipe -floop-interchange -floop-strip-mine -floop-block -Wall -W -Wextra -Wno-long-long -Wno-overlength-strings -Wunsafe-loop-optimizations -Wundef -Wformat=2 -Wlogical-op -Wsign-compare -Wformat-security -Wmissing-include-dirs -Wformat-nonliteral -Wpointer-arith -Winit-self -Wdeclaration-after-statement -Wfloat-equal -Wmissing-prototypes -Wredundant-decls -Wmissing-declarations -Wmissing-noreturn -Wshadow -Wendif-labels -Wcast-align -Wstrict-aliasing -Wwrite-strings -Wno-unused-parameter -ffast-math -fno-common -fdiagnostics-show-option -Wl,-z -Wl,nodelete -Wl,-z -Wl,now .libs/pulseaudioS.o -o .libs/pulseaudio daemon/pulseaudio-caps.o daemon/pulseaudio-cmdline.o daemon/pulseaudio-cpulimit.o daemon/pulseaudio-daemon-conf.o daemon/pulseaudio-dumpmodules.o daemon/pulseaudio-ltdl-bind-now.o daemon/pulseaudio-main.o daemon/pulseaudio-server-lookup.o -Wl,--export-dynamic  -L/usr/local/ssl/lib -L/usr/local/BerkeleyDB/lib -L/usr/X11/lib -L/usr/local/lib64 ./.libs/libpulsecore-5.0.so -L/usr/xorg/lib -L/usr/local/lib -L/usr/lib64 /usr/local/lib/libsamplerate.so /usr/local/lib/libspeexdsp.so /home/fraga/src/pulseaudio-5.0/src/.libs/libpulse.so /usr/local/lib/liborc-0.4.so ./.libs/libpulsecommon-5.0.so ./.libs/libpulse.so /home/fraga/src/pulseaudio-5.0/src/.libs/libpulsecommon-5.0.so /usr/xorg/lib/libX11-xcb.so /usr/xorg/lib/libSM.so /usr/xorg/lib/libICE.so /usr/lib64/libuuid.so /usr/xorg/lib/libXtst.so /usr/xorg/lib/libXi.so /usr/xorg/lib/libXext.so /usr/xorg/lib/libX11.so /usr/xorg/lib/libxcb.so /usr/xorg/lib/libXau.so /usr/xorg/lib/libXdmcp.so /usr/lib64/libsystemd-journal.so /usr/local/lib/liblzma.so /usr/local/lib/libgcrypt.so /usr/local/lib/libgpg-error.so /usr/lib64/libsystemd-id128.so /usr/local/lib/libjson-c.so /usr/local/lib/libsndfile.so /usr/local/lib/libltdl.so /usr/local/lib/libdbus-1.so /usr/local/lib/libgdbm.so -lcap -lpthread -lrt -ldl -lm -pthread -Wl,-rpath -Wl,/usr/local/lib/pulseaudio -Wl,-rpath -Wl,/usr/xorg/lib
/home/fraga/src/pulseaudio-5.0/src/.libs/libpulse.so: undefined reference to `is_error'
collect2: error: ld returned 1 exit status
Makefile:6365: recipe for target 'pulseaudio' failed
make[3]: *** [pulseaudio] Error 1
make[3]: Leaving directory '/home/fraga/src/pulseaudio-5.0/src'
Makefile:4655: recipe for target 'all' failed
make[2]: *** [all] Error 2
make[2]: Leaving directory '/home/fraga/src/pulseaudio-5.0/src'
Makefile:756: recipe for target 'all-recursive' failed
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ory '/home/fraga/src/pulseaudio-5.0'
Makefile:591: recipe for target 'all' failed
make: *** [all] Error 2

	***

	Any hints? Thanks.

-- 
Linux 3.16.0-00115-g19583ca: Shuffling Zombie Juror
http://www.youtube.com/DanielFragaBR
http://exchangewar.info
Bitcoin: 12H6661yoLDUZaYPdah6urZS5WiXwTAUgL




More information about the pulseaudio-discuss mailing list